2005 Kia Sorento vs. 2005 Volkswagen Passat

To start off, both 2005 Kia Sorento and 2005 Volkswagen Passat were released in the same year (2005).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. Both 2005 Kia Sorento and 2005 Volkswagen Passat are equipped with a 2,496 cc eng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Volkswagen Passat (161 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 22 more horse power than 2005 Kia Sorento. (139 HP @ 3800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Volkswagen Passat should accelerate faster than 2005 Kia Sorento.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Kia Sorento weights approximately 490 kg more than 2005 Volkswagen Passat.

Let's talk about torque, 2005 Volkswagen Passat (351 Nm @ 1500 RPM) has 31 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Kia Sorento. (320 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2005 Volkswagen Passat will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Kia Sorento.
